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Rishikesh, don't miss the opportunity to visit the Beatles Ashram, also known as Maharishi Mahesh Yogi Ashram. This abandoned ashram was once the residence of the Beatles during their spiritual journey in the late 1960s. It now serves as a peaceful retreat for meditation and yoga enthusiasts. Another hidden gem is the Neer Garh Waterfall, a tranquil waterfall surrounded by lush greenery, perfect for a refreshing dip.

Local favorites in Joshinath include the Vasundhara Falls, a breathtaking waterfall located near the Mana Village. The scenic beauty and the sound of gushing water make it a must-visit spot. An offbeat attraction in Auli is the Chenab Lake, a serene lake nestled amidst the snow-covered mountains. Enjoy a picnic or simply unwind in the lap of nature.
